In an interview with Eugenio Scalfari, Pope Francis indicated the unemployment of the young and the solitude of the elderly as the biggest challenge that the Church faces today.
 
«The most serious evils that have come to afflict the world in recent years are unemployment of the young and the solitude in which the elderly are left. The elderly need care and companionship, and the young work and hope; but they have neither, and the trouble is that most of them don’t seek them. They are stuck to the present. Tell me: can a person live crushed under the weight of the present? Without a memory of the past and without the desire to look ahead to the future by building something, a future, a family? Can one go on like this? This, in my view, is the most urgent problem that the Church is facing today».
